Hey Priya — handing over the Quillbase static-analysis setup. Heads up: the baseline file (`sa-baseline.yml`) suppresses about 140 legacy findings so new PRs stay clean. Don't let anyone add fresh suppressions without a ticket — that's the whole game. I've been burning down roughly ten entries a sprint. The suppression policy and the burn-down tracker are on the page below.

runbook for fajep-yahop: https://rundeck.braskdata.example/repo/run/pages/job/dfe5b8c563356906

## Tuning

The Moonharbor tide-table widget interpolates between station readings, so small constant changes visibly shift the rendered curve. Please test against the Saltgrove fixture set before committing, and note that refresh intervals trade accuracy against bandwidth on coastal kiosks. Each value is documented inline in the source. The current defaults are shown below.

constants for tageg-kagag:
QUOTAS = {
    "kelax": 495,
    "istath": 366,
    "tammir": 108,
    "novdor": 730,
    "casax": 816,
    "quenael": 874,
    "pelius": 403,
}

## Locker Assignment — Changing Rooms, Fenby Building

Team assistants allocate lockers via the facilities roster each Monday. Lockers 1–40 are for permanent staff; 41–60 for visitors and temps. Unclaimed lockers are cleared monthly. Padlocks are not permitted; all lockers use the keypad system. Program new assignments using the master code below.

door code, yagap-bahof: bdg-O-05